The Espressif Systems ESP32-S3-BOX-3 open-source AIoT kit, available from Mouser, is a feature-rich development tool based on the ESP32-S3 Wi-Fi® + Bluetooth® 5 Low Energy system-on-chip (SoC) featuring AI acceleration capabilities. The SoC also features 512KB SRAM, supported by 16MB of quad flash and 16MB of octal PSRAM. The kit also contains a 2.4-inch (320 x 240) SPI touchscreen, two digital microphones, a speaker, a USB Type-C™ port, and a high-density PCIe connector for hardware expansion. The ESP32-S3-BOX-3 delivers a speech-recognition framework that provides users with an offline AI voice assistant with far-field voice interaction, continuous recognition, wake-up interruption, and the ability to recognize over 200 customizable command words.

The ESP32-S3-BOX-3 is a versatile device that supports the Matter protocol, enabling users to utilize it as a Matter-over-Wi-Fi/Thread end-device, a Thread border router, or a Matter gateway. Additionally, the ESP32-S3-BOX-3 supports working with the open-source, home-automation platform and home assistant, thus providing users with a powerful, local home controller that rivals Amazon Echo and Google Home. The outstanding AI capabilities and low power consumption of the ESP32-S3-BOX-3 make it the ideal choice for smart home automation, delivering seamless connectivity and effortless control over a wide range of devices.

Espressif’s AIoT Cloud platform, ESP RainMaker®, can be used with ESP32-S3-BOX-3 to configure GPIOs and offline voice commands while also offering remote control via phone apps or third-party voice assistants. Espressif’s ESP Insights software provides a remote diagnostics solution to monitor the functioning of the ESP32-S3-BOX-3 in the field, thus ensuring optimal performance at all times.
